The full breakdown
What it's made of and why it matters
Solo Grips cups are molded polystyrene (PS, #6 plastic) with an applied grip coating, likely a polymer or elastomer layer to improve handling. Polystyrene itself is a stable plastic at room temperature but degrades when exposed to heat, solvents, oils, and mechanical stress. The grip coating composition is not publicly disclosed by Solo, which means its stability, leachability, and potential additive profile cannot be independently verified. This product is designed for cold beverages primarily, not hot drinks.
The brand's record and disclosure
Solo has not publicly disclosed the chemical composition of the grip coating on this product line, nor has the company published transparency reports on food-contact additives or manufacturing processes. Solo is owned by Dart Container Corporation, a major single-use plastics manufacturer with no widely recognized third-party certifications (such as FDA food-contact validation) specific to this product. The company has faced no major recalls for this cup model on public record, but lack of disclosure is a common practice in the disposable cup industry rather than a sign of exceptional safety.
How it compares in its category
Solo Grips cups are among the most widely distributed disposable cold-beverage cups in North America and compete with similar polystyrene offerings from Dart, Chinet, and private labels. They perform comparably to uncoated polystyrene cups in terms of leaching risk during normal cold use, but the undisclosed grip coating introduces a variable not present in plain cups. Coated paper cups or glass alternatives eliminate the polystyrene concern entirely but cost more and are less widely available. Polystyrene cups generally rank lower in consumer safety perception than polypropylene or polycarbonate alternatives, though all plastics carry some additive and degradation risk.
If you buy it
Use these cups only for cold or lukewarm beverages; hot drinks increase leaching of polystyrene monomers and potentially unknown grip-coating additives. Do not microwave, freeze for extended periods, or allow them to sit in direct sunlight for hours, as these stresses degrade polystyrene and coatings. Replace cups if you notice visible cracks, whitening, brittleness, or coating separation. For frequent beverage use, reusable stainless steel or glass containers eliminate this material class concern entirely and reduce waste.
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
Polystyrene monomer and oligomer leaching
Polystyrene can leach small amounts of styrene monomers and oligomers into beverages, especially when liquid sits for extended periods or contact time is prolonged. Risk is low at room temperature with cold drinks but increases if cups are heated, exposed to oily or alcoholic beverages, or stored in warm environments.
Undisclosed grip-coating additives
Solo does not publicly disclose the chemical identity of the grip coating. Typical elastomer coatings may contain plasticizers, colorants, or other processing aids not regulated under current FDA guidance for food-contact articles, creating uncertainty about leaching potential.
Coating degradation and microplastics
The grip coating can chip, flake, or degrade over the product lifetime, especially with physical stress or repeated washing if cups are reused. Flaking particles may shed into beverage or be ingested, though the extent of this risk with normal single-use is unknown.
BPA and bisphenol analogs in polystyrene resins
Polystyrene itself does not contain BPA as a structural component, and BPA is not typically used in styrene-based plastics. No recalls or reports link Solo Grips cups to BPA contamination.
Off-gassing and volatile organic compounds
Polystyrene and applied coatings may off-gas volatile organic compounds, especially in warm storage or when first unpacked. Odor or smell is often the only consumer indicator; long-term health risk from food-contact off-gassing is not well characterized at typical exposure levels.
